비디오 중심 파이프라인에 Roboflow 사용 방법
How to Use Roboflow for Video-Heavy Pipelines
핵심 요약
- ▸ByteTrack, Time-in-Zone 로직, Roboflow 워크플로우를 활용해 고속 비디오 파이프라인을 구축하는 방법을 학습합니다.
- ▸클라우드나 엣지 환경에서 비디오 처리 효율을 높이는 전략을 제공합니다.
- ▸비디오 데이터 처리 시 시스템의 스케일링과 성능 최적화에 대한 통찰을 제공합니다.
- ▸비디오 처리 파이프라인을 효율적으로 설계하고 확장성을 높이는 데 중요한 도구입니다.
심층 분석
Roboflow는 비디오 처리 파이프라인을 효율적으로 구축하기 위한 플랫폼으로, 특히 ByteTrack과 같은 객체 추적 기술을 활용해 고성능의 비디오 분석을 가능하게 합니다. ByteTrack은 객체 추적을 위해 밀도가 높은 시퀀스에서 객체를 정확하게 추적할 수 있도록 설계되어, 비디오에서의 실시간 분석에 적합합니다. Time-in-Zone 로직은 특정 영역 내에서 객체가 얼마나 오래 머무는지 계산하여, 예를 들어 교통 관리나 보안 시스템에서 유용하게 활용됩니다. Roboflow Workflows는 클라우드나 엣지 환경에서 실행되며, 다양한 데이터 처리 단계를 자동화하여 개발자의 작업을 단순화합니다.
이 기술은 개발자들에게 고성능 비디오 분석을 구현하는 데 큰 영향을 미칩니다. 특히, 실시간 데이터 처리가 필요한 애플리케이션에서는 처리 속도와 정확도를 동시에 확보할 수 있어, 교통 관리, 제조 자동화, 보안 시스템 등 다양한 분야에서 활용 가능합니다. 또한, Roboflow의 워크플로우 기능은 개발자가 복잡한 파이프라인을 쉽게 구성할 수 있도록 해주어, 개발 시간을 절약할 수 있습니다.
개발자들은 비디오 처리 시 데이터의 품질과 시각화를 고려해야 합니다. 예를 들어, 입력 데이터의 해상도나 프레임 속도가 처리 성능에 직접적인 영향을 미치므로, 적절한 설정이 필요합니다. 또한, 클라우드와 엣지 환경에서의 성능 차이를 고려해, 적절한 배포 전략을 수립해야 합니다. 마지막으로, 데이터 보안과 프라이버시 문제도 주의해야 하며, 로컬 처리나 암호화 기능을 활용해 보안을 강화하는 것이 중요합니다.